Dinner with Ten Braves


This volunteer opportunity allows you the chance to engage with current students, offer advice about life after college, and create meaningful and lifelong connections. From a casual backyard barbecue to a fancy four-course dinner, the type of experience you want to create is completely up to you. The Student Alumni Association handles all logistics including marketing to students, arranging carpools from campus, and facilitating communication between students and hosts. Hosts cover the dinner expenses and provide an amazing opportunity for a group of Braves to connect. We'd love to have you join us as a dinner host!
